SAN ANTONIO — The Control Systems Group recently held its spring meeting at the Hyatt Regency in San Antonio. The meeting, which was hosted by TDIndustries, was attended by more than 40 members and guests representing independent control service and installation contractors from the U.S. and Canada.

The meeting included highly technical roundtable discussions on BACNet and LON integration, chiller systems integration and optimization, chiller control retrofits, Niagara (Tridium) framework utilization, and best practices.

A roundtable discussion was conducted where each member gave regional updates on the controls business in their area and challenges they face. A demonstration was also given by member company Chillco on integrating dissimilar control boards using a test panel they fabricated. In addition, there were technical and product presentations by Honeywell, Control Solutions, and Belimo.

Emphasis was placed on offerings and solutions for systems integration. Subjects included refrigerant and gas detection, energy conservation through demand response, networkable interface products, Web-enabled devices, gateways, drivers, and an energy-conserving control valve.

The group’s 2014 annual meeting will be held in Jacksonville, Fla., and will be hosted by Thermaserve.
